Rhawn St & Edrick St
Advertisement
4201 Rhawn St
Philadelphia, PA 19136
At the bus stop at Rhawn St & Edrick St in Philadelphia, passengers wait for their transport while surrounded by the hustle and bustle of the city.
Generated from this place's information
See a problem?
You might also like
Advertisement